Full Data Comparison
| Metric | Amarillo, TX | Columbia, MO |
|---|---|---|
| 💰 Cost of Living | ||
| Cost of Living Index National avg = 100 · lower = cheaper | 90.8 | 89.3 ✓ Cheaper |
| Median Home Value | $172,700 ✓ Lower | $248,600 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$997 | $997 |
| 📈 Income & Economy | ||
| Median Household Income | $60,628 ✓ Higher | $60,455 |
| Unemployment Rate | 3.5% ✓ Lower | 4.0%⚠ High |
| Avg Commute Minutes each way | 18.5 min | 16.5 min ✓ Shorter |
| Work From Home % | 4.9% | 7.6% ✓ Higher |
| 🔒 Safety | ||
|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er · 60% violent / 40% property | 160⚠ High | 99 ✓ Safer |
| Violent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 182⚠ High | 91 ✓ Safer |
| Property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 126⚠ High | 110⚠ High ✓ Safer |
| 🎓 Education | ||
| School Quality 100 = national avg · grad rate, staffing & attainment | B- (92) | A (123) ✓ Better |
| Student-Teacher Ratio Lower = smaller classes | 14.5:1 | 12.8:1 ✓ Smaller |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 25.2% | 55.3% ✓ Higher |
| High School or Higher | 86.1% | 95.4% ✓ Higher |
| School District Name only — no quality rating available | AMARILLO ISD | COLUMBIA 93 |
| 🌤 Weather | ||
| Avg High — January | 50.7°F ✓ Warmer | 39.3°F |
| Avg High — July | 92.0°F ✓ Warmer | 88.6°F |
| Annual Precipitation | 19.7" ✓ Drier | 44.8" |
| Annual Snowfall | 17.2" ✓ Less | 17.4" |
| 👥 Demographics | ||
| Population | 200,360 ✓ Larger | 126,172 |
| Median Age | 34.4 ✓ Older | 28.8 |
| Homeownership Rate | 59.6% ✓ Higher | 48.8% |
| Under 18 | 26.5% ✓ More | 19.0% |
| Over 65 | 14.5% ✓ More | 11.1% |
